[QUOTE="Preacherman, post: 3839079, member: 11033"] I hope that you are doing good today. You have asked a serious question about your eternal destination. There have been many beliefs that have been posted and you can see they very. That being said the question to ask is "what does the bible say?" There is only one unforgivable sin and that is blasphemy of the Holy Spirit. There is only one thing that precludes a person from going to Heaven and that is not being born again. I will list some passages that will help you answer if you have been or not. Some passages that have already been stated have been taken out of context. I suggest that you look these up and read them for yourself. When you do remember that the Scripture is not open to personal interpretation. John 3:3-8 ...Unless one is born again, he cannot see the kingdom of God Here is what being born again looks like. Matthew 7:21-23 ...he who does the will of My Father in Heaven. Do you? John 10:27 My sheep hear My voice and I know them, and they follow Me. Do you follow? Romans 10:9-10 ...with the heart one believes unto righteousness... Right living according to Scripture. 2 Thessalonians 1:3-12 ...taking vengeance on those who do not obey the Gospel. Do you? 1 John 5:1-5 Loving God is shown by keeping His commandments. Do you keep His commandments? 2 John 1:9-11 ...abides in the doctrine of Christ. Do you abide in the Scriptures? Hebrews 10:25 not forsaking the assembling of ourselves together. Do you go to church? If you have been born again here are some benefits 1 Corinthians 10:13 is about temptation not about what you can handle in life. 2 Corinthians 1:8-11 God will give you more than you can handle However, you can handle anything through His power when your trust is in Him. 2 Corinthians 1:3-5 Blessed is the God of all comfort who comforts us in all our.... I fail at these most every day in some way. When a born-again Christian fails we do not stay in the failure but confess that sin and get right back to following. Do I have personal experience? Yes, I was my dad's caretaker and lost him in 2019 to cancer. God was glorified in how my dad faced cancer and his death. If you are born again then God will give you the strength to handle cancer in a way that will glorify His name. [/QUOTE]
